Documentation
Definition
Specifies the category of the first-level checks:
- Required Fields
For the FI document in question, the system checks the fields stored under Assign Check Objects (document header and item). If one of the fields does not contain a value, the system displays the message First-level check: Enter a correct value for field '&1' (GLE_ECS_MSG_S, 002), and creates an ECS item. You can use up to 20 fields.
- Customer-specific checks
The system interprets the values stored under Assign Check Objects as function modules. Function module GLE_ECS_FL_ERCS_SAMPLE is a sample fm that you can use as a template for creating your own function modules. Parameter E_TAB_ITEM_MSG can contain a message. If an exception is triggered, the system displays the message First-level check: Custom check failed (GLE_ECS_MSG_S, 004) and creates an ECS item.
